Lightweight

If you're looking for a wheelchair for your child that is lightweight, it's important to know what to look for. A heavy wheelchair can make it difficult to lift it in a car or up stairs. It is also important to take into consideration the weight of your accessories, which can add up quickly. There are a variety of lightweight options that are durable and cost-effective.

When looking for a lightweight folding wheelchair for children, it's important to choose the right chair for the body size of the user. There are models that come in a range of sizes, from small to large, while others can be adapted to fit a specific user. It is also crucial to think about the level of comfort your child requires. The type of cushioning in a wheelchair can have a significant impact on how comfortable it is.

A child's seat should have adjustable features. These features include adjustable armrests and foot plates as along with a variety of wheels and tires. The right size of tires can also make a huge difference in how easy it is to push the chair.

Although lightweight wheelchairs can be more expensive than their standard counterparts initially however, they're usually less expensive in the long run because they're made of sturdy materials. They are also easier to maneuver and operate.

Adjustable

Consider the adjustability and materials when choosing the right wheelchair. The standard steel chairs are generally heavy and are not adjustable. There are also ultra-lightweight, lightweight chair options made from Enigma Aluminum Transit Wheelchair 18 Inch Seat alloys. They are lighter and have a variety of adjustable features. They are ideal if you have to move your child quickly. In addition to the options for adjustment, it's important to consider whether you want a rigid or folding model. The rigid frames are more durable and efficiency, but they don't fold, so they are more suitable for long-term use. Folding wheelchairs are simpler to transport and are ideal for those who need them occasionally.

Pediatric wheelchairs can be powered by arms, legs or a caregiver. They are available in a variety of styles, including standard/manual, lightweight/ultra-light, transport/folding, tilt-in-space and alternative/recreational. The right chair depends on the individual requirements of the user and whether a stand-up wheel chair is required.

Pediatric manual wheelchairs are available in a variety of styles, including standard/manual, lightweight/ultra-light, transport/folding, power/electric and alternative/recreational models. Certain models are designed to evolve with the child and others are specifically designed for specific needs and activities. When selecting a chair for children, the most important factors are the user's measurements as well as the location and time of use and the features they require.

For instance, if you need a wheelchair for frequent visits to the park you must consider specifications such as the turning radius to ensure that the chair is able to move in these settings. If you plan to use the wheelchair for extended durations, you should consider whether it comes with an ergonomic chair that is designed according to your child's body shape and posture.

Another crucial aspect to take into consideration is the durability of the wheelchair and its construction. The wheelchair should be constructed using high-quality materials in order to ensure its safety and longevity. It should also be equipped with features that enable it to endure a variety of environmental conditions. This includes an axle on the front that can be adjusted to the appropriate height and caster wheels with high-torque hubs to decrease the amount of resistance to rolling.
